Ameroseiidae
The family Ameroseiidae is one of the three families of mites under the superfamily Ascoidea. There are about 12 genera and more than 130 described species in Ameroseiidae.
The family has a worldwide distribution.

Ascidae
Ascidae is a family of mites in the order Mesostigmata.
